Stay informed about important activities in your CRM with customizable notifications. Choose which updates you want to receive and how you want to receive them.
Click your profile icon in the top right, then select "Settings".
Click on "Notifications" from the settings menu to configure your notification preferences.
Note: Notification settings are personal to each user. Your preferences don't affect other team members.
Choose which activities trigger email notifications:
Get notified when new deals are created in your organization. Useful for staying aware of new opportunities and pipeline activity.
Receive notifications when deals are updated or moved to different stages. Helps you track deal progress and team activity.
Get alerted when new contacts are added to your CRM. Stay informed about new leads and potential customers.
Receive reminders for upcoming and overdue tasks. Never miss an important follow-up or action item.
Get reminded about scheduled meetings before they start. Includes meeting details and attendee information.
Receive a weekly summary of your CRM activity, including deals won, tasks completed, and upcoming priorities.
The daily digest is a summary email sent once per day with your most important information:
Choose what time you want to receive your daily digest. The default is 9:00 AM UTC, but you can adjust it to match your schedule.
Tip: Set your digest time for early morning so you start each day with a clear view of your priorities.
Each notification type has a toggle switch. Click the switch to enable or disable that notification.
Use the time picker to select when you want to receive your daily digest. Time is in UTC (Coordinated Universal Time).
Click "Save Changes" at the bottom of the page to apply your notification preferences.

Begin with fewer notifications enabled. You can always turn more on if you're missing important updates.
The daily digest is a great way to stay informed without constant interruptions. Enable it and disable individual notifications.
Task and meeting reminders are critical for staying on top of your work. Keep these enabled even if you disable other notifications.
Managers need different notifications than individual contributors. Customize based on what's relevant to your role.
Your notification needs may change over time. Review your settings every few months and adjust as needed.
